In this episode, Savannah brings to the podcast table her concern for a dear friend who is had her own fears about changing her gender expression when it comes to her femininity. From a Girl-Next-Door vibe to the pinks and frills and ponytails of the world of Sissies, how does an established and admired social media darling go from a developed visual trans-brand many in the community look up to a brand new idea of what femininity looks and feels like for her? Julie and Savannah bat around in conversation the need to be authentic to your own needs above all others. Cast fear aside, embody and embolden your truth, and never break at the words of the naysayers.
